M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
considers
subjects
related to open
education resources
and
massively open online courses.
Recent
developments in
e-learning have made it possible for
humans
in every nation on earth
to take courses via the Internet.
These MOOC courses are
normally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
There are many
issues that
elearning institutions
have to deal with
more than ever because learning technology is
advancing so quickly.
How can participants
be assured that
the quality of these
MOOC classes is
passable?
How can stakeholders
be assured that
educators are properly credentialed
and qualified to teach massive open online courses?
What different business models are being used by
organizations like
Johns Hopkins University to conduct these massively open online courses?
What experimental teaching practices and evaluation strategies are optimal?
How can participants
handle problems like
inadequate
student motivation and high
student attrition?
